“Keep Calm and Carry On.”

keep calm and carry on

It’s the ultimate British mantra for dealing with chaos. This quote embodies unflappable stoicism and a stiff upper lip. When things go pear-shaped, just maintain your cool and carry right on.

“Mind the Gap.”

It’s the iconic warning heard in London’s underground. An everyday reminder to avoid unexpected mishaps. A symbol of British practicality with a touch of humor.
